BRAY ADVANTAGES LOWER TIER COMPETITOR DISADVANTAGES


Energized seat design provides reliable sealing performance Low-pressure sealing performance is not reliable, due to
at low and high pressures. non-energized seat design.

Excellent high-pressure performance in both directions, due Inferior sealing performance, as seat is pushed away from
to pressure assisted sealing technology. disc when high pressures are applied from stem side.

Resilient energizer ensures “zero-leakage” performance Sealing performance is compromised after a few thousand
through several hundred thousand cycles. cycles, due to material loss.

Seat design prevents suspended particles/solids on the Seat design allows suspended particles to be trapped
fluid stream from getting trapped between seat and the around the seat cavity, causing damage to the seat, thereby
sealing cavity. drastically reducing sealing performance and seat life.

Firesafe seats and metal seats are made with robust Firesafe seats are made with stainless steel, which has only
Inconel 718 material, which provides excellent strength 20% yield strength of Inconel 718. Metal seats are made with
and resiliency. Inconel 625, which has only 40% yield strength of Inconel 718.

Robust disc/seat design allows minimal deflection of the Poorly engineered discs cause significant deflection at high
disc, maintaining sealing performance at high pressures. pressures, leading to leakage — even during standard API
598 testing.

Body design incorporates additional material, allowing “Compromised-for-cost” design does not provide additional
retainer screws to be outside sealing area of gasket, thereby material, requiring the retaining screws to pass through
providing an uninterrupted sealing surface. the gasket — causing gasket damage during installation,
resulting in potential leakage.

Inbuilt metal-to-metal gasket compression limiter prevents Retainer sits directly on gasket — which can cause uneven
over-compression of gasket. compression, and potential gasket blowout.

Valves designed up to ASME Class 600. Limited range in size and pressure classes.

Demonstrated field experience in size range up to 66 inches


on ASME Class 150.
